The Enduring Allure of the Evil Eye Silver Bracelet in 2026

The evil eye symbol, known historically as the mati in Greek heritage and nazar suraksha across India and the Middle East, is believed to deflect negative energies and envious thoughts. While the talismanic meaning remains deeply cherished, its fusion with 925 sterling silver has turned it into a high-fashion modern statement.

Several distinct factors make sterling silver the ideal precious metal for evil eye jewellery in 2026:

  • Cool Luminous Tonal Harmony: The crisp, reflective white tone of sterling silver provides the perfect neutral canvas, making the vibrant cobalt blue, turquoise, and white enamel shades of the evil eye pop with striking clarity.
  • Daily Wear Durability: Solid 925 sterling silver offers exceptional tensile strength and structural integrity, making it far superior to base metal fashion jewellery that tarnishes or bends easily.
  • Hypoallergenic Comfort: Premium 925 silver is nickel-free and lead-free, ensuring gentle, irritation-free contact on sensitive wrist skin throughout long days of wear.
  • Effortless Mix-and-Match Potential: Silver pairs harmoniously with stainless steel wristwatches, white gold accents, and cool-toned precious pieces like platinum couple rings, giving you complete styling flexibility.

1. Minimalist Solitaire Evil Eye Silver Chain Bracelet

For those who subscribe to the beauty of understated luxury, the minimalist solitaire chain bracelet remains the supreme choice. This design features a delicate, diamond-cut cable or curb chain in 925 sterling silver anchored by a single petite bezel-set evil eye charm measuring between 6mm and 8mm. The charm is typically crafted with hand-painted vitreous blue and navy enamel, or set with a tiny central sapphire-toned cubic zirconia stone. Its ultra-lightweight profile ensures it never snags on knitwear or sleeves, making it the quintessential everyday companion for office professionals.

2. Dual-Tone Enamel & 925 Sterling Silver Evil Eye Nazariya

Reinterpreting traditional Indian wrist talismans with a fresh, contemporary touch, the modern silver nazariya bracelet alternates bright sterling silver beads with polished black onyx or tourmaline beads flanking a central evil eye motif. Unlike heavy traditional threads, modern silver nazariyas use durable, anti-stretch silver box chains or flexible wire links with secure lobster clasps. This design bridge connects cultural heritage with chic daily wear, offering meaningful protection in a clean, polished silhouette.

3. Cubic Zirconia Halo Evil Eye Silver Tennis Bracelet

When you want to blend protective symbolism with evening glamour, the halo tennis bracelet stands unmatched. In this opulent design, the central evil eye charm is encircled by a sparkling halo of precision-cut micro-pavé cubic zirconia stones. Flanking the centrepiece is a continuous line of faceted stones set in four-prong sterling silver basket links. The rhodium-plated silver finish magnifies the optical brilliance of the stones, creating a mesmerising wrist piece suited for wedding cocktails, gala dinners, and milestone celebrations.

4. Adjustable Slider Evil Eye Silver Bolo Bracelet

The bolo slider bracelet has become one of the fastest-growing jewellery categories due to its effortless adjustability. Featuring an ergonomic silicone-lined sterling silver slider bead, this bracelet allows the wearer to customise the circumference smoothly from 5.5 inches up to 8.5 inches with a simple one-handed glide. The delicate chain ends are finished with polished silver droplets or evil eye charms that sway gracefully beneath the wrist. Its universally adaptable fit makes it the ultimate thoughtful gift option.

5. Multi-Charm Symbolic Evil Eye Silver Link Bracelet

For enthusiasts who love narrative jewellery, multi-charm link bracelets offer dynamic charm and movement. Along a sturdy paperclip link or rolo chain in sterling silver, multiple protective talismans are suspended at measured intervals, including the central evil eye, the Hamsa hand of Fatima representing strength, lucky four-leaf clovers, and horseshoe motifs. Each charm catches the light independently as you move, creating a playful yet meaningful visual symphony.

6. Beaded Silver & Mother-of-Pearl Evil Eye Protective Band

Natural gemstone and shell textures bring an organic warmth to fine jewellery. This design incorporates a carved mother-of-pearl shell disc as the eye iris, giving off a rainbow-like iridescence under natural sunlight. Surrounded by tiny 2mm faceted sterling silver spacer beads, the mother-of-pearl evil eye feels soft, feminine, and bohemian. It is especially popular for brunch styling, resort getaways, and breezy summer linen ensembles.

7. Modern Rigid Silver Cuff with Inlaid Blue Enamel Eye

If you prefer structured wrist jewellery over fluid chains, the rigid silver cuff offers a bold architectural presence. Cast in substantial 925 sterling silver with a slight oval contour for wrist comfort, this open-ended torque bangle features terminal evil eye motifs inlaid with cold enamel or set with cabochon stones. It slips comfortably over the side of the wrist and can be gently adjusted for a snug, modern fit that pairs impeccably with sharp blazers and tailored dresses. Understanding 925 Sterling Silver Purity, BIS Hallmarking & Craftsmanship

Investing in a sterling silver evil eye bracelet requires understanding the technical aspects of silver purity and certification in India. Pure silver (999 fineness) is exceptionally soft and malleable, making it prone to bending, scratching, and losing gemstone settings under regular friction. To solve this, master jewellers alloy 92.5% pure fine silver with 7.5% strengthening metals, predominantly copper, creating 925 Sterling Silver.

When purchasing your bracelet in India, keep these vital quality benchmarks in mind:

  • The BIS Hallmark Standard (IS 2112): In India, silver jewellery hallmarking is governed by the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S) standard IS 2112. A certified silver piece features the official triangular BIS logo, the fineness grade stamp (such as “925”), and the jeweller identification mark.
  • 6-Digit HUID Traceability: Modern hallmarked jewellery in India includes a unique 6-digit alphanumeric Hallmark Unique Identification (HUID) code. You can verify your piece authenticity directly via the government BIS Care App.
  • Anti-Tarnish Rhodium Micron Plating: Silver naturally reacts with ambient sulfur in the air to form silver sulfide, commonly seen as tarnish. Premium sterling silver bracelets feature an electrolytic flash plating of pure rhodium, a precious platinum-group metal that imparts a brilliant mirror shine and prevents oxidation.
  • Enameled Setting Resilience: Verify that the coloured evil eye disc uses hard vitreous glass enamel or cured resin enamel that resists chipping, fading, or moisture damage during daily handwashing.

Caring for Your Sterling Silver Evil Eye Bracelet: Cleaning & Maintenance Tips

Sterling silver is a durable precious metal, but simple routine care ensures your bracelet maintains its bright lustre and protective enamel detailing for years to come:

  • Keep Away from Harsh Chemicals: Remove your silver bracelet before swimming in chlorinated pools, soaking in hot tubs, or applying perfumes, body lotions, and hairsprays, as sulfur and chlorine accelerate tarnishing.
  • Gentle Home Cleaning: Clean your bracelet by soaking it in lukewarm water mixed with a few drops of mild dish soap for 5 minutes. Gently wipe with a soft lint-free microfiber cloth, and pat completely dry. Avoid abrasive baking soda pastes on enamel or mother-of-pearl surfaces.
  • Air-Tight Anti-Tarnish Storage: When not wearing your bracelet, store it inside an airtight ziplock pouch with an anti-tarnish silica strip, away from direct sunlight and bathroom humidity.
  • Inspect Clasps and Jump Rings: Periodically examine the lobster clasp and jump ring attachments to ensure they remain firm, tight, and secure during daily movement.
